The Baptist Convention of Western Cuba (Template:Langx) is a Baptist Christian denomination in Cuba. It is affiliated with the Baptist World Alliance. The headquarters is in Havana.

History

The Baptist Convention of Western Cuba has its origins in an American mission of the International Mission Board in 1898.<ref> William H. Brackney, Historical Dictionary of the Baptists, Scarecrow Press, USA, 2009, p. 171</ref> It is officially founded in 1905.<ref> J. Gordon Melton, Martin Baumann, Religions of the World: A Comprehensive Encyclopedia of Beliefs and Practices, ABC-CLIO, USA, 2010, p. 289 </ref> According to a census published by the association in 2023, it claimed 561 churches and 28,022 members.<ref> Baptist World Alliance, Members, baptistworld.org, USA, retrieved May 5, 2023</ref>
